Hi @matan.grady
Reminders are sent to users listed as Atlas project owners every Friday morning (local time):
Here is the help article that I took the table from. It has more details about locale/timezone of users in relation to reminders and the weekly digest:

From what I can tell and experience, I get reminders only for projects that has active followers.
When a project doesnt have any, I don't get reminder.
